Luka is a male given name that has its origins in various cultures and languages. In Slavic languages, Luka is a derivative of the name Lucas, which means "man from Lucania" in Latin. In some African languages, Luka means "bringer of light" or "bright." It is also a popular name in Italy, where it is typically a shortened version of the name Luca. The name Luka has gained popularity in recent years and is often associated with qualities such as intelligence, creativity, and kindness.

Famous people named Luka
Luka Modrić | football player | Croatian footballer, Real Madrid and Croatian national team captain, won the Ballon d'Or in 2018 |
Luka Dončić | basketball player | Slovenian basketball player, currently playing for the Dallas Mavericks in the NBA, won the NBA Rookie of the Year award in 2019 |
Luka Bloom | singer-songwriter | Irish folk singer-songwriter, known for his introspective and poetic lyrics and fingerstyle guitar playing |
